Plan International Bangladesh recently hosted a national dissemination workshop to present its scoping study, "Understanding SRHR, WASH, and Livelihoods Situations and Pathways Forward in Climate-Vulnerable Locations of Southwest Bangladesh," highlighting critical service gaps and recommending evidence-based policy and programmatic interventions.

Workshop Unveils Climate Justice Initiative

Saudi Arabia Connects 7.8 GWh Battery Storage Project to Grid

Saudi Electricity Co. has completed a massive storage project across three sites, enhancing grid stability and renewable integration. Once fully operational, the installation will become the world's largest battery energy storage system (BESS). The Kingdom of Saudi Arabia has officially completed grid connection of its landmark battery energy storage project, with a nameplate capacity of 7.8 GWh.
